Moving into our living room, I've added some bright pops of colour to make it feel fresh and ready for the new season. Styling Tip: One single floral pillow adds enough of a burst of colour and pattern to make an entire room feel like Spring!
This bright floral pillow is designed by one of my favourite fellow Canadian bloggers - Lucy of Craftberry Bush - and you can find it here. Styling Tip: To make a dark leather couch feel lighter, surround it with light and bright colours like white and gray.
On our coffee table, I've filled a barnwood box with blue mason jars, candles and pink tulips.
Styling Tip: Mix faux greenery and florals with real ones for a lower budget look for Spring. I made these flowers using this DIY method right here, and then I set them in a glass vase with acrylic water. Styling Tip: Fill a transparent glass vase with real or acrylic water when using faux florals to give them a more realistic look.
